The size of Branxton is approximately 33.4 square kilometres. It has 3 parks covering nearly 0.7% of total area. The population of Branxton in 2016 was 1991 people. By 2021 the population was 2255 showing a population growth of 13.3%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Branxton is 50-59 years. Households in Branxton are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Branxton work in a trades occupation.In 2021, 84.20% of the homes in Branxton were owner-occupied compared with 79.40% in 2016.
